### Audit Item 14 — Printspire Spooler Microservice

Verify that the Printspire spooler drains its job queue within the five-minute SLA during the nightly audit window. Check that stale jobs older than 24 hours are purged, that retry counts are capped at three, and that the dead-letter topic is empty or ticketed. Confirm TLS is enforced on all printer endpoints and that the service account rotates credentials on schedule. Record findings in the audit log, then obtain acknowledgement from the service owner identified below.

account owner for bawip-tahag: Raleth Quenok

For branch managers of Corvane Mills. The central training allocation rises 6% overall, weighted toward the Ashport and Tillow branches where turnover has been highest. External course spend is capped at last year's level; in-house delivery through the Harrowgate Academy programme absorbs the increase. Managers should submit draft training plans by end of quarter, flagging any certification renewals separately. Unspent funds will no longer roll over. The following confidential note outlines the planning assumptions behind these figures.

management briefing: The finance team signed off on a budget of $385.6 million for Project Istys.

Handing the locale-aware date formatting work in Fennelworth's billing portal over to Priya-track. The formatter now resolves patterns per-tenant instead of per-server, which fixed the Marovia region complaints about day/month ordering. Remaining items: the fallback chain still defaults to the server locale when a tenant has no preference set, and the relative-date strings haven't been translated for the Quellish locale pack. To reproduce my test setup, the service needs the following configuration values applied before startup.

service settings:
[casax]
port = 6379
team = rusir
host = casax.zemvarhq.corp
region = outer-4
access_code = ac_9808ce
timeout_ms = 1500

Ticket: Staging env misconfigured for Siftgate bloom filter

The bloom layer in front of the Pellet KV store is rejecting all lookups in staging because the env file was copied from the dev template without credentials. False-positive tuning values are fine; only the auth line is missing. To unblock the weekly demo, the Pellet admission secret must be set on the following line.

env line for yaguf-fajop: LEDGER_TOKEN13=fb08984397349